A very dangerous one is what you yourself think is right but is actually wrong. The goodnews bible puts it this way: “What you think is the right road may lead to death.” (Proverbs 14:12 GNB). This calls for caution on what you hold as your personal belief, ideas, and principles. Wait and ponder a little. Where did you get the ideas you live by from? A person’s mind on issues are formed by his exposures in life. You live the way you live today because of the background where you grew up. The first set of knowledge you acquired when you were growing up in your locality, your early school, the peers you related with, the films you watched and the teachings you listened to whether formally or informally all contributed to what has become your personality today. The danger here is that people generally don’t bother about God’s requirements for living as they exert their influences on you. Neither did you ever think of God when you were forming your opinions on divers issues of life. Your mind on different issues determines your actions and inactions. The environment where you grew up together with all exposures you have had in life have worked together to form your views and positions on issues. Formation of life goes on unconsciously as you are exposed to diverse environments, situations and circumstances. You must consciously settle down at this juncture and find out whether what you have settled for as your own way of life is acceptable to God. Would God approve of your life when you appear before Him on the day of judgement? What if this position you have taken on issues is actually wrong according to Christ’s standard? You need to submit your life to the scrutiny of the Holy Scriptures so you can amend your ways.
“Do not conform yourselves to the standards of this world, but let God transform you inwardly by a complete change of your mind. Then you will be able to know the will of God — what is good and is pleasing to him and is perfect.” (Rom. 12:2 GNB). God is ready to help you. That is why He begins to show you the Word of God to assist you not to continue to defend your understanding of issues and the way you have been living before now. He expects you to allow His Word to replace your former positions on issues. That’s the only way a child of God can become right and acceptable to God.
Now, remember that Christ is the Word of God. When you renew your heart by the Word of God, you are making allowance for Christ to change your life. In Philippians 2:5 the Bible says “Let this mind be in you which was also in Christ Jesus,”. (NKJV). That’s how to be right. Forgo your own mind and replace it with the mind of Christ. The Word of God is the written mind of Christ. Overhaul your heart with the Word of God and you will find grace to please God in every situation.
